Daniël van Kaam is a 25-year-old football player who plays as a central midfielder for RKC Waalwijk, born on June 23, 2000, who is left-footed. In the 2025/2026 Eerste Divisie season, Daniël van Kaam has recorded 1 goal, 3 assists, 2,135 minutes, an average FotMob rating of 6.95, 1 yellow card.
Daniël van Kaam scores highly on Assists, Minutes, and Rating compared to central midfielders in the Eerste Divisie.

Daniël van Kaam's career has also included time at Heracles, Cambuur, and FC Groningen.
On the international stage, Daniël van Kaam has represented Netherlands U21 and Netherlands U17.
